Antigravity 2.0 — Technical Architecture, Enterprise Specs & Workflow Overview§

1. Executive Summary & Market Positioning§

Antigravity 2.0 is an enterprise AI solution operating within the Productivity & Ops ecosystem. Engineered for developers, product managers, and enterprise teams, Antigravity 2.0 delivers specialized AI automation under a paid model. It eliminates manual friction across digital workflows by integrating targeted machine intelligence into daily operational pipelines.

Core Focus: Next-generation AI workflow automation platform that orchestrates multi-agent pipelines, intelligent data routing, and autonomous task execution across any connected service.

Deployable for both individual productivity and scaled organization-wide adoption, Antigravity 2.0 prioritizes operational reliability, low latency execution, and compliance. Verified independent software profile.

3. Developer Integration & API Specifications§

Integration specs and technical access parameters for Antigravity 2.0:

  • API Accessibility: Available via REST API
  • Supported Integration Platforms: Slack, Gmail, GitHub, Notion, OpenAI API, Anthropic API, Google Drive
  • Context Limit / Input Memory: 128,000 Tokens
  • Output Capacity: 4,096 Tokens
  • Customization Framework: Standard parameters and workspace system prompts

For engineering teams automating programmatic workflows, Antigravity 2.0 interface endpoints accept authenticated HTTPS requests with JSON payloads.
